I have lzw'd (Telamon zipped) a group of priv files (an image db), then ftp'd to 
another machine. Then when I lzw unzip on the other machine this causes a 
Priv file violation. The log-on user and group (and acct) have pm capability. 
This does work on a different machine. This also does work on this machine 
with non-Priv files. The difference I see is: works from 6.0 to 6.0, priv files 
don't work from 6.0 to 5.5, non-priv files do work from 6.0 to 5.5.

:lzw "-r -f rxzz -q"
LZW: (C) 1991, 1999 - Telamon, Inc. - Version A.03.50 [A.02.04] (Sep  7 
1999)
  (Unisys U.S. Patent No. 4,558,302 - see -about for details)
Restore (Expand)
Use archive file: rxzz
RX.TESTDATA.RX;REC=128,1,F,BINARY;DISC=57,1;CODE=-400
(iroot);ULABEL=26
   (-m 13) 07/10/26 07:54:35
Restore file RX.TESTDATA.RX [CR for yes, ? for help]: rx
***PRIVILEGED FILE VIOLATION  (FSERR 45)
 
+-F-I-L-E---I-N-F-O-R-M-A-T-I-O-N---D-I-S-P-L-A-Y+
!  ERROR NUMBER: 45    RESIDUE: 18767    (WORDS) !
!  BLOCK NUMBER: 1377842229   NUMREC: 20000      !
+------------------------------------------------+
***Error number: 1103

Thanks for your prior experience in this case.
